Town of Danville/Philip Emilio land in question
Chris Giordano stated that the town forest had been surveyed and in the process a discrepancy regarding some missing acreage was discovered. Mr. Philip Emilio of Map 1-50 is stating his parcel contains 149+/- acres but the Town maps and tax cards reflect 112+/- acres.
Carol Baird summarized the existing situation and presented the Board with back up information, which has already been sent to Doucet Survey, Inc. The correspondence states “…in 1914 a Danville tax collector named John Heath made an error in the locus description and the book and page reference in a tax foreclosure deed that he issued to James Merrill of Haverhill, Mass.” As a consequence the Town presently has a deed that has “color of title”.
The Board unanimously approved Chris Giordano and Carol Baird meeting with Town Council for legal opinion on how to proceed to clear up this discrepancy.
